Essential Responsibilities:

Candidate performs various duties in support of U.S. Navy flight line aircraft maintenance operations at NAS Norfolk, VA. VAW-120. Duties include, but are not limited to: fueling; de-fueling; engine oil servicing; direct incoming and outgoing aircraft near hangar area to assist pilots maneuvering of the aircraft on ground, using hand or light signals; pre-flight, post-flight, daily/turnaround, special and conditional inspections on aircraft; secures aircraft in parking position with chocks, tie down chains and grounding wires; check for fuel contamination by draining samples from low point drains; operate ground support equipment such as electrical power supply, tow tractor, light cart, and engine starting unit; clean exterior or interior of aircraft, using portable platform ladders, brushes, rags, water hoses, and vacuums interior floors of aircraft.

Perform all other position related duties as assigned or requested.

Minimum Requirements

Must have a High School diploma or GED.Must be able to speak, read, write and understand the English language.Minimum of one (1) year actual and recent experience of organizational level aircraft maintenance, and flight line maintenance is recommended. Previous experience on (E-2C/E-2D/C-2A) aircraft desired.Knowledge and use of special tools/equipment required to perform assigned maintenance tasks is preferred.Shift work and travel, to include work on Naval ships, is required.Ability to read and interpret technical publications, safety rules, operating and maintenance instructions and procedure manuals.Must be able to meet physical requirements associated with and/or pass any medical examination requirements related to performing daily assigned tasks. There is a great deal of standing, climbing, bending and stooping. Must be able to lift up to 50 pounds.Must possess and maintain a valid Virginia driver's license (or North Carolina drivers license if North Carolina resident) and be able to operate a government general-purpose vehicle.Work is performed primarily outdoors under all types of weather conditions with exposure to loud noise, exhaust fumes, and various types of chemicals.Must be able to obtain an approved status from the Contractor Verification System which includes a 7 year background check and obtain a Security Clearance for Public Trust.
